Intel Core i5-4670 Need For Speed Benchmarks - Can Core i5-4670 Run Need For Speed?

Mid-range Desktop processor released in 2013 with 4 cores and 4 threads. With base clock at 3.4GHz, max speed at 3.8GHz, and a 84W power rating. Core i5-4670 is based on the Haswell 22nm family and part of the Core i5 series.
